When the United States Bureau of Mines BoM was closed in , Congress transferred certain BoM functions to DOE including research of the extraction, processing, use and disposal of mineral substances, and functions pertaining to mineral reclamation industries and the development of methods for the disposal, control, prevention, and reclamation of mineral waste products.
See Pub. Through this funding opportunity announcement FOA , the Advanced Manufacturing Office AMO seeks to address gaps in domestic supply chains for key critical materials for clean energy technologies to:. This will be accomplished through development of alternative next-generation technologies and field validation and demonstration of technologies that improve extraction, separation and processing.
Key critical materials for energy technologies as defined in this FOA include: rare earth elements: neodymium Nd , praseodymium Pr , dysprosium Dy , terbium Tb , and samarium Sm used in permanent magnets for electric vehicle motors, wind turbine generators and high temperature applications; cobalt Co used in batteries used in electric vehicles EVs and grid storage and high temperature permanent magnets; and lithium Li , manganese Mn and natural graphite used in batteries see table below.

The purpose of this RFI is to solicit feedback from interested individuals and entities, such as industry, academia, research laboratories, government agencies, and other stakeholders on the Plastics Innovation Challenge PIC Draft Roadmap. This will help to to ensure the Plastics PIC is optimally positioned to address opportunities and challenges for the development and deployment of technologies for plastic waste management and reduction.
This is solely a request for information. The PIC Draft Roadmap serves as a unifying document, providing structure and aligning activities across the offices of the Department involved in this effort. The PIC considers approaches to plastic waste management from fundamental science all the way to technology development and field validation.
By providing alignment within the Department, a framework to provide appropriate focus on select strategies to manage plastic waste, and objectives at every level of technical maturity, this roadmap will guide the Department in its efforts to meet the PIC goals. Department of Energy DOE Weatherization Assistance Program WAP reduces energy costs for low-income households by increasing the energy efficiency of their homes, while ensuring their health and safety.
The program supports 8, jobs and provides weatherization services to approximately 35, homes every year using DOE funds. Since the program began in , WAP has helped improve the lives of more than 7 million families through weatherization services.
If you're interested in learning more about applying for weatherization services, contact your state WAP program and they can assist in identifying the local organization that serves your area.
